Wombat Creek · Suburb / Locality
How far people went at school, the qualifications they hold and what they studied.
Few changes have been seen in the schooling patterns of Wombat Creek over the last decade. The area is marked by a significant gap in high school completion, with only 40% of residents finishing Year 12.
Highest year of school completed.
Year 12 completion is far below the national figure of 58.8% and the state's 61.8%. In this area, 24% of people stopped at Year 10 and 16% at Year 11.

Post-school qualifications and degrees.
Adults with a bachelor degree or higher make up 16.7% of the population. This is well below the Australian average of 26.3% and far below Victoria's 29.2%.

What people studied.
The most common field of qualification is Engineering & related at 19%, ahead of Management & commerce (19%).
